Paris, 1835. Twenty-five-year-old Fryderyk Chopin is at the peak of his career – frequenting salons, captivating the aristocracy, delighting the King of France and audiences across Europe. This is the period when he creates his most important works, and every night brings a new concert or ball.

Michał Kwieciński's film reveals an unknown side of the composer – one full of passion, wit, and a yearning for freedom. It's the story of a man for whom love and music become the meaning of life.

"Chopin, Chopin!" is one of the most ambitious undertakings in Polish cinema in recent years. Over 600 people, 260 actors, and as many as 5,000 extras, participated in the production. Impressive costumes, meticulously reconstructed interiors, and the atmosphere of 19th-century Paris create an evocative backdrop for this unique story.

Eryk Kulm, winner of the Eagle Award and the Zbyszek Cybulski Award, takes on the title role. He is joined by Joséphine de La Baume as George Sand, Lambert Wilson as King Louis Philippe I, and Maja Ostaszewska, Karolina Gruszka, Dominika Ostałowska, Kamil Szeptycki, and Martyna Byczkowska.

Filming took place in Poland, France, and Spain, including Bordeaux, Mallorca, and Lower Silesia. The film's music was provided by a team of experts from the Fryderyk Chopin Institute.
